山东招远界河金矿床断裂构造特征及其控矿规律 被引量:1

Characteristics of the fracture structure and ore-controlling regularities in Jiehe gold deposit,Shandong province

摘要 界河金矿床为胶东地区典型的蚀变岩型金矿床,矿床产于望儿山断裂的北段,矿体的产出严格受断裂构造控制。矿区断裂构造主要由F1、F2主断裂及一系列次级断裂组成,矿体主要受F1主断裂控制。主断裂沿走向及倾向均呈现波状起伏的特征,其在主成矿期具有左型走滑的正断层性质。主断裂面凸凹转换部位对成矿最有利,其控制了矿体沿走向呈似等距性分布以及向南西侧伏的规律。次级断裂的类型以及构造岩的类型和破碎程度控制了不同的矿化类型。次级节理裂隙发育的频度控制着裂隙脉型矿化的强弱,形成了在主断裂与次级断裂收敛部位富集成矿的"断夹片式"控矿构造模式。通过断裂构造控矿规律分析推断,在Ⅰ号矿体深部存在一定的找矿前景。 Jiehe gold deposit, a typical altered rock type gold deposit in Jiaodong area, occurs in northern Wang'ershan fault zone and is strictly controlled by fracture structures. The fracture structure of the deposit consists of the main fractures, F1 and F2, and a sequence of subfractures. The orebody is mainly controlled by F1 fracture. The main fracture surface that is a normal fault of sinistral strike-slip in the main metallogenic stage presents undulation a- long trend and tendency. The transferring sites between concave and convex of the fracture surface are the favorable places where gold orebodies occur, which also has controlled the regularities of the equidistant distribution of gold de- posit along strike and the lateral trending of northeast-southwest. The degrees of mineralization are controlled by the types of secondary faults, the types and fragmentation degrees of the tectonite. The frequency of secondary joint fissure control the mineralization intensity of fissure vein type, and it established a model of broken clamping piece type that the minerals are enriched at the convergence site between the main fracture and the sub. Based on the study of the fault-controlled regularities,it is inferred that there are good prospects of mineral exploration in deep orebody I.
